Latest Patents
Tansey's most recent patents focus on calibration material delivery devices and methods. One of her notable innovations includes a device designed to facilitate the delivery of control materials effectively. This device features a user-friendly design, comprising a first portion that users can grasp easily and a second portion that houses a reservoir containing a control material. This control material is pivotal as it contains a target analyte in a known or predetermined concentration.
Additionally, she developed a method for verifying the accuracy of analyte monitoring devices. This process involves receiving a fluid sample, identifying it as a control solution, and conducting an analysis to ensure the reliability of the monitoring device.
